Saudi Arabia sends oil prices soaring with surprise production cut




Saudi Arabia has surprised the market with a large cut in crude production, a bold assertion of primacy over the global oil industry that came directly from the kingdom’s de facto ruler.The move papered over cracks in the OPEC+ coalition and was a U-turn from some recent Saudi oil-policy priorities, but those things paled in comparison next to the global impact of the decision.
